     PLEASE NOTE: 
           A piano keyboard is touch sensitive when the volume of sound increases when
         the keys are depressed faster.   If you're not sure if it is touch sensitive, call
         us at 519-858-2805.  The picture to the left shows a keyboard that is            
         probably touch sensitive.  Any smaller and it probably is not.
